Apple has registered seven as yet unreleased new iPad models in the Eurasian Economic Commission database this week. Indian blog MySmartPrice reports the models are designated as: A2123, A2124, A2126, A2153, A2154, A2133, and A2152.

Apple is legally required to file with the commission for any encrypted devices intended for sale in Armenia, Belarus,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, and Russia.

No word on what versions of iPad these registered models could turn out to be. However, a new iPad mini and new version of the 9.7-inch iPads have been rumored by multiple sources.

China Times and DigiTimes both have published predictions of a new “iPad mini 5,” as well as a new entry-level iPad, possibly boasting a 10-inch display. Well-connected Apple analyst Ming-Chi Kuo has also predicted that a new iPad mini will hit shelves in the near future.

Previous Eurasian Economic Commission filings have foreshadowed new Apple product on numerous occasions, include numerous iPad and iPad Pro models, the iPhone 7 and iPhone 7 Plus, Apple Watch Series 2 and Series 4, and many other devices.

Apple hasn’t given any update love to the iPad mini since September 2015, so the little tablet that could is definitely due an update.
